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 563616 - Re-locate Tox Project overlay
Summary: Re-locate Tox Project overlay
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Infrastructure
Classification: Unclassified
Component: Gentoo Overlays (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Gentoo Overlays Project
URL: https://github.com/Tox/gentoo-overlay...
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2015-10-20 21:41 UTC by David Zero
Modified: 2015-10-26 20:33 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description David Zero 2015-10-20 21:41:05 UTC
The Tox Project overlay now lives in the Tox organization on Github. The current URL still functions with a redirect, but this should only be temporary; we'd like the proper URL shown in the Layman list.

The updated information is as follows:

Overlay Name: gentoo-overlay-tox
Description: Ebuilds for Toxcore, Tox clients, and other Tox-related projects
Owner Name: The Tox Project
Email: infrastructure@tox.chat


Thanks,

David Zero
The Tox Project

Reproducible: Always
Comment 1 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-10-23 17:59:47 UTC
Ok, I'm going to guess it's about 'tox-overlay'. So:

1. I've updated the URLs and description.

2. If you want repository name changed, please update profiles/repo_name first. Then I'll update the overlay name. Note that layman won't know the overlay name changed, so users will have to manually delete and readd it.

3. As for owner's e-mail, it must match an existing Bugzilla account so that the bugs about the repository can be reliably reported to the owner. Please either register an account for the infrastructure@ address or provide another e-mail address that has Bugzilla account registered.
Comment 2 Zetok 2015-10-24 10:14:52 UTC
Hello.

I'm the maintainer of the overlay for Tox - though repo I'm maintaining is not located under `Tox/`, but under `zetok/`: https://github.com/zetok/gentoo-overlay-tox.

Regarding what David wrote:

>The Tox Project overlay now lives in the Tox organization on Github.

It lived there, and was transferred by me under my account.


Since info needs to be updated - I've updated repository.xml.

Thanks for your time.
Comment 3 David Zero 2015-10-24 10:22:32 UTC
Please excuse Zetok. He did in fact maintain the repository, but recently fell out with the project, and won't take "no" for an answer as far as responsibility for the overlay goes. He no longer represents the Tox Project. The proper location of the overlay is, in fact, under the Tox Github organization.

I've registered a bugzilla account with "infrastructure@tox.chat" so that the owner email may be changed.

Thanks,
David Zero
The Tox Project
Comment 4 Zetok 2015-10-24 10:29:56 UTC
>Please excuse Zetok. He did in fact maintain the repository, but recently fell out with the project, and won't take "no" for an answer as far as responsibility for the overlay goes. He no longer represents the Tox Project. The proper location of the overlay is, in fact, under the Tox Github organization.

I'm still maintaining the overlay - and will do so as long as I will be able to / there will be need to maintain it.


Now, If "Tox Project" is capable of actually maintaining the overlay - that's great, I could have more free time.

Sadly, I don't believe that this is the case - though if I'm wrong about that, all the better :)
Comment 5 David Zero 2015-10-24 10:56:03 UTC
You do not maintain THE overlay. You maintain one copy of the overlay, whose changes I will be happy to regularly merge into the official repository, pending sanity checks.

Maintainer or not, you have no grounds on which to claim sole ownership of the project's overlay. That said, I would appreciate it if you took your complaints about the project to a more appropriate forum.
Comment 6 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-10-26 16:17:06 UTC
Please don't expect us to solve your disputes. I've updated the URL since the new requested URL matched the redirect in place. I really don't have a problem having both your overlays in Gentoo but one of them would have to be renamed.
Comment 7 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-10-26 17:16:45 UTC
@David, I've updated the contact info. Please make sure to watch the bugmail on the relevant address (or just 'watch' the address using Bugzilla's watching feature) since this is the official way of communicating issues with repositories.

@Zetok, if you'd like to add another repository for Tox, feel free to open a bug and I'll handle it. Just please remember to update profiles/repo_name as well ;-).
Comment 8 Zetok 2015-10-26 18:36:23 UTC
@Michał Górny Sorry, but I think that I'm not going to do that - what I'm maintaining is an overlay for Tox stuff. Changing its name, etc strikes me as something rather very weird, and counter-productive.

*shrugs*

It's sad though how users will be directed to something that isn't even maintained.
Comment 9 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-10-26 19:22:31 UTC
@Zetok, there's nothing forbidding you from getting your ebuilds directly into ::gentoo and proxy-maintaining them. If you'll open a pull request against gentoo/gentoo, I'll be happy to review it and help you get it into proper quality, then I can merge it for you.
Comment 10 Zetok 2015-10-26 20:33:18 UTC
@Michał  Thanks! Sounds great to me. I've been meaning to do that, but I'm not quite sure how things are supposed to work - e.g. ensuring that things will be up-to-date (given how rapidly things at Tox change, things can become outdated quite fast).

Well, I guess I'll be asking when I won't know something :)


I'm going to start making PRs for ebuilds either tomorrow (~24h from now) or in 2-3 days, depending on when I will have time.